Darrell Arthur is a professional basketball player who plays Power Forward for the Denver Nuggets as number 00. Arthur was born on March 25, 1988, in Dallas, Texas. Arthur’s height is 6 ft 9 in. Arthur’s weight is 235 pounds. This article takes a deep dive into Darrell Arthur’s net worth.
In high school, Darrell Arthur played basketball for South Oak Cliff High School (Dallas, Texas). Arthur played basketball in college with Kansas Jayhawks men’s basketball (2006-2008) and started playing professionally in 2008. In the 2008 National Basketball Association draft, Arthur was chosen number 27 in round 1 by the New Orleans Hornets.
Arthur played for the Memphis Grizzlies during 2008-2012 as well as the Denver Nuggets in 2013-present. Some of the highlights of Darrell Arthur’s career include: List of NCAA Men’s Division I Basketball champions, First-team All-Big 12 Conference, Big 12 All-Rookie Team, McDonald’s All-American Game, and Texas Mr. Basketball.
